    Six charges, three positive and three negative of equal magnitude are to be placed at the vertices of a regular hexagon such that the electric field at O is double the electric field when only one positive charge of same magnitude is placed at R. Which of the following arrangements of charges is possible for P, Q, R, S, T and U respectively [IIT-JEE (Screening) 2004]

    A)                                                      \[+,\,-,\,+,\,-,\,-,\,+\]

    B)                    \[+,\,-,\,+,\,-,\,+,\,-\]

    C)                    \[+,\,+,\,-,\,+,\,-,\,-\]

    D)                    \[-,\,+,\,+,\,-,\,+,\,-\]

    Correct Answer: D

    Solution :

               If the charges are arranged according to the option D, the electric fields due to P and S and due to Q and T add to zero, while due to U and R will be added up.
